About Aluko & Oyebode
Established as a full-service international practice, Aluko & Oyebode operates across a diverse range of sectors, offering legal expertise in areas such as:
- Banking and Finance
- Corporate and Commercial Law
- Dispute Resolution & Litigation
- Telecommunications
- Intellectual Property
- Energy and Natural Resources
- Project Finance and Infrastructure
- Real Property and Construction
- Taxation and Compliance
- Privatization and Regulatory Affairs
The firm’s offices are strategically located in Lagos, Abuja, and Port Harcourt — Nigeria’s key commercial and administrative hubs — enabling it to serve clients efficiently across the country and beyond.
Aluko & Oyebode combines corporate and commercial expertise with a robust litigation and Alternative Dispute Resolution (ADR) practice, ensuring a well-rounded and dynamic environment for young lawyers to grow.

Eligibility Criteria
To be considered for the Aluko & Oyebode NYSC Associate Programme 2026, applicants must:
- Hold an LL.B Degree with a minimum of Second-Class Honours (Upper Division) – 2:1.
- Be eligible to participate in the National Youth Service Corps (NYSC) programme following completion of Law School in 2026.
- Demonstrate strong analytical, communication, and problem-solving skills.
- Exhibit professionalism, integrity, and a keen interest in corporate and commercial law practice.
